Successful Easter for First Camp – over 30% more guest nights compared to previous record years

Remove

Easter 2025 was a record start to the camping season. First Camp, Scandinavia's largest camping chain, saw a more than 30 percent increase in the number of guest nights at its Swedish destinations compared to the last record year of 2022, when Easter fell just as late in the spring. For the entire chain, guest nights increased by 26 percent. Despite the changeable April weather, more people than ever chose to start the season at First Camp.

”"Even in uncertain times in the world, camping is standing very strong and we are very pleased that the first major camping weekend of the year attracted a record number of guests, despite unstable weather. We also see that our continued investments in our product and guest offering are resulting in extra high demand. Ahead of this year, we have made major investments in, among other things, upgraded service buildings, mini golf courses and newly built cabins and camping sites,", says Johan Söör, CEO of First Camp.
